Output f405807e17d41fe31f524a34fb67f00a41131eda7fd39bafeef1bd80afc3fcb2:0

value
12700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ad49d5108980df6c2cae5700511e76d36737e7 OP_EQUAL
address
3KSNc3mLUHJLp4hMT8iQkTkZ6XtepPSqbm
transaction
f405807e17d41fe31f524a34fb67f00a41131eda7fd39bafeef1bd80afc3fcb2
confirmations
268484
spent
true